When Lives Depend on Speed and Clarity

First responders often work in hazardous environments where delays can cost lives. Traditional chemical testing required sending samples to a lab—an expensive, time-consuming process that slowed response and increased risk.

Our client, a global leader in thermal imaging, set out to change that. Their goal: deliver lab-quality answers directly in the field through a portable device. To succeed, the software had to be fast, intuitive, and reliable even for users wearing heavy gloves and protective gear.

An Intuitive Interface for Critical Decisions in the Field

SEP worked side by side with the client’s hardware team to bring their vision for portable lab test equipment to life. Our focus was on the people who would rely on it most: first responders making decisions under pressure.

Usability That Works Through Gloves and Gear

We designed a touchscreen interface built for protective gear — large, easy-to-press buttons and uncluttered screens meant responders could get answers without fumbling. Every workflow was streamlined to show only the most critical data, helping users act quickly in hazardous environments where seconds matter.

Built to Adapt as Field Needs Evolve

We didn’t just design for the launch—we designed for the future. With a visual design guide and adaptable architecture, the client can evolve the software as needs change, ensuring first responders always have reliable, easy-to-use tools in the field.
